A1: Electric fireplaces tend to be the most economical in terms of preliminary purchase price and setup, however can have higher operating expense compared to gas or pellet systems.
Q2: Are gas fireplaces safer than wood-burning fireplaces?
A2: Yes, gas fireplaces normally produce fewer emissions and pose a lower threat of chimney fires as they don't produce creosote like wood-burning systems.
Q3: Can I install a fireplace myself?
A3: While some electric fireplaces permit easy self-installation, other types, particularly gas and wood-burning models, typically need professional installation due to venting and safety issues.
Q4: How do I maintain my fireplace?
A4: Regular upkeep includes cleaning the chimney (for wood-burning fireplaces), looking for gas leaks (in gas systems), and ensuring correct ventilation for electric designs.
